Rudolfo Hernandez Medal of Honor

Rudolfo Hernandez, a paratrooper with the 187th Airborne Regimental Combat Team during the summer 1951 United Nations counter-offensive, earned the Medal of Honor on this day for his aggressive defense of Hill 420 against Chinese communist troops.  After running our of grenades and rifle ammunition, Hernandez charged with the bayonet, killing six enemy before collapsing from his extensive wounds.
